Smart Tips To Put Makeup When You Have Rosacea

Rosacea can be described as severe skin disorder that commonly affects people with fair complexion, usually Caucasians. Its key characteristic is the reddening within the central part of the face area particularly inside the nose, cheeks, forehead, and chin, swelling of the affected region followed with spread of papules and pustules, prolonged and noticeable flushing, and visible lines of arteries over the face.

Rosacea is a common problem among Caucasians, and in America alone, it can be presumed there presently exist 14 million people who suffer this disorder. In addition, women are almost three times more prone to have this condition than men. Although it is normally a harmless issue, it may cause changes in the appearance of those that develop the condition and could influence their self-esteem since they may become too conscious of what they look like. Fortunately though, those afflicted with this disorder can use cosmetic makeup products to mask the symptoms of rosacea in their face. Below are a few makeup tips that could enhance the feel of the facial skin and increase the self-confidence of those who have rosacea.

For starters, clean and moisturize the facial skin using mild products. Stay away from rough, abrasive materials on your skin because they could cause irritations. Also, it is advisable to use less products as you possibly can to reduce the exposure of your skin to potential irritants. In addition, in case you are unclear about this product you will use, test it on your arms or neck first before applying it on your face.

Employing a green-tinted base is ideal for people with rosacea as it can help correct the skin redness and even out complexion. For concealers and foundation, choose the ones that are oil-free especially if there is a growth of papules and pustules. The foundation should also match the person’s natural complexion and the concealer ought to be one shade lighter. Don’t use sponge or fingertips in applying foundation because it is better to apply anti-bacterial brushes to apply makeup to minimize skin irritation.

For the makeup, choose mineral powder because it does not have ingredients that will possibly aggravate the skin. Some are even developed to color-correct the redness of your skin. Blushers are optional since people who have rosacea already have plenty of color for their skin, even though there are mineral powder blushers available if using this is a must. In addition there are mineral powder eye shadow and that is recommended should you have rosacea with eye involvement. Finally for your lips, choose those that have neutral shade near the natural lip color so as not to point out the redness in the skin.

Rosacea: Checking Out The Signs and Symptoms

 

Rosacea is an epidermis issue that generally affects Caucasians, with the nickname the “curse of the Celts”. Whoever has the situation can have prolonged skin blushing within the central areas of the face. It’s typically viewed as a harmless aesthetic issue unless it affects the eyes. Rosacea is more typical in females than guys, although it’s often more critical in the cases of the latter. The reason for this condition is currently unknown though it is theorized that it’s caused by either enhanced amounts of the peptide cathelicidin and stratum corneum tryptic enzymes, incident of tiny intestinal tract bacterial overgrowth, blocking of oil glands by dedomex mites, and genetic condition.

The primary sign of rosacea is the facial reddening activated by flush inside the central areas of the face, specifically within the forehead, nose, chin, and cheek, despite the fact that it may also impact the neck, ears, chest, and scalp. Following frequent episodes of flushing, the reddening might aggravate into a permanent state. This usually leads to folks confusing it for a sun-burn or windburn.

As the situation advances, puffiness as well as burning sensations may possibly be sensed by the man or woman affected. An episode of inflamed papules (tiny reddish bumps) and pustules (red bumps with pus) may possibly happen within the impacted area. Simply because of this, some mistake this issue as adult acne though in rosacea, there are no comedones (blackheads and whiteheads). Also, the blood vessel might dilate and produce visible red lines called telangiectasia within the inflamed skin.

Throughout the critical stage of this issue, the affected individual may well experience severe episodes of face flushing, severe skin inflammation, facial soreness, creation of cysts and delibitating burning sensations. For males with the condition, rhinophyma also takes place where the oil glands on the tip on the nose hypertrophies and thickens, producing an enlarged, bulbous nose.

At times the eye is also involved in this condition which is known as ocular rosacea. In this problem the eyes may have a watery or bloodshot appearance, foreign body feeling, burning or stinging sensation, itching, dryness, blurred vision, light sensitivity, visible blood vessel lines of the conjunctiva, burning eyelids, inflamed conjunctiva, and irregular eyelid margin.

Overview Of The Various Types of Rosacea

 

Numerous people associate Rosacea to Caucasian, that is why it is known as the Curse of the Celts. It is characterized by redness of the skin in numerous areas of the face particularly in the nose, cheeks, forehead, and chin. It often affects females more than males and starts at around the age of 30 to 50. The signs and symptoms of rosacea includes burning sensation of the face, inflammation of pastules and papules, visible blood lines within the face, and in severe cases in men, the abnormal growth of the nose. There are also cases of Rosacea where the eye is involved either by reddening of the eyes or occurrence of sties.

You will find 4 different kinds of rosacea, and those who have the condition might get one of these four. The very first type of Rosacea is known as erythematotelangiectatic rosacea. It is characterized by flushing and persistent skin redness. Dilated blood vessels that causes visible red lines in the face, called telangiectasia, might be present too even though it’s not necessary for the diagnosis of this type of rosacea. It may also include other symptoms such as central facial edema, roughness, and stinging and burning sensations. Those people who only have a history of flushing is often diagnosed with erythematotelangiectatic rosacea.

The next variety of rosacea is papulopustular rosacea. This kind of condition is actually marked by central face inflammation paired along with reddish humps (papules) together with several pus loaded (pustules) which lasts for about four days. This condition is frequently confused with acne breakouts, except that there are usually no blackheads (comedones). Burning together with stinging feelings might also be existing in this condition. Papulopustular rosacea is often recognized in addition with erythematotelangiectatic rosacea. The particular presence of telangiectasia may be overlooked as a result of the chronic redness of the pores and skin and papules and pustules.

Phymatous rosacea is the next type of rosacea and is often linked with rhinophyma or the swelling of the nasal area. This particular situation is designated by the thickening of the epidermis and irregular surface nodularities. Aside from the nose, it may additionally affect the chin (gnatophyma), cheeks, eye-lids (blepharophyma), forehead (metophyma), and ears (otophyma).

Managing Rosacea Blushing

 

Rosacea can be described as reoccuring skin problem that is characterized by reddening of the central part of the face, in the cheeks, chin, forehead, and nose area. Also known as since the “curse of the Celts,” this situation generally impacts Caucasians and people with fair skin. It affects both sexes although females tend to be more probably to have the condition than males, although it has much more extreme effects in men. It generally appears in around age 30 to 50 and is generally wrongly diagnosed for adult acne because of the papules and pustules that may possibly accompany the condition. Other individuals also mistake it for too much sun or wind-sore because of the reddening that is an important symptom of rosacea.

Reddening performs an essential part in the improvement of rosacea. Whenever somebody blushes, their arteries and in the face dilates because of the stimuli and opens up to let more blood flow in thus causing the redness of the skin. People who are usually prone towards the situation often display early symptoms of rosacea in the form of regular blushing. Regular reddening may then change the bloodstream, creating it more reactive to stimulation and opening up for prolonged amounts of time, therefore leading to the lingering redness of the skin. This is already a form of mild rosacea.

As the situation gets more extreme, the frequent blushing could significantly trigger structural problems towards the arteries in the head, inducing long term blushing in the skin. The blood vessels turn out to be dysfunctional and are completely dilated, which allow large volumes of blood to stream to the face.

In a nutshell, frequent blushing can lead towards the development of the issue especially if the person is more vulnerable to have it in the very first place. People who suffer this situation however can avoid stimuli that might provoke episodes of reddening in order to further worsen their circumstance. Some of the things that they are able to do are staying away from intense exercise, heat from sunlight, cold wind, heat, stress, anxiety, extreme sunburn, and transferring between places with polar conditions. They can also prevent meals that leads to blushing like booze, caffeine, foods high in histamine, hot food, and foods higher in Niacin.

Knowing The Various Causes Of Rosacea

 

Rosacea is 1 of the many conditions that are best known for excessive blushing for those who have it, particularly in the forehead, cheeks, nose, and chin. It can also affect the eye which may cause a burning and itching sensation. Rosacea generally hits people with fair skin color, particularly Caucasians, and adult females are more likely to have it than men. Rosacea usually affects middle-aged people and many can take it wrongly and diagnose it as adult acne because, like acne, you are able to discover pustules and papules. Other indications are blood vessel lines in the face, red gritty eyes, burning and stinging of the face, and in severe cases in males, the formation of knobby bumps in the nose known as rhinophyma.

The real cause of rosacea isn’t exactly known, but researches have put forth various theories on how it can develop. Because rosacea starts using the flushing of the skin color, many trace the situation to vascular problems triggered by complication in the blood vessels.

1 theory is that rosacea is brought on by elevated amounts of cathelicidin, a peptide that protects the skin against infection, combined with elevated amounts of enzymes called stratum corneum tryptic enzymes (SCTE). It’s said that too much amounts of these two might trigger the signs and symptoms of rosacea.

One other feasible cause of rosacea is bacteria called H.plyori which resides within the gastrointestinal tract, as more of this bacteria build up in the stomach, the hormones that are also produces can lead to skin flushing.

Demodex mites that live in facial hair follicles are also suspected to cause rosacea. These mites may clog the sebaceous glands in the face thus causing the blushing of the skin.

Scientists have also observed that Rosacea can develop if your family members have this situation within the first place. This points out that rosacea can be brought on by a genetic predisposition that’s set off by specific environmental factors.

Other elements that might contribute to skin flushing are numerous. These include exposure to the sun, spicy foods, drinking hot beverages and alcohol, strenuous exercise, tension, anxiety, cold wind, strong cortisone creams, vasolidating drugs, perfumed cosmetics, among others.

Diet Plan Against Rosacea

 

Rosacea is really a very severe conditions that mostly affects Caucasian as well as individuals that are fair-skinned. This problem is seen as a prolonged inflammation of the face, especially within the central areas in the nose, chin, cheeks, and forehead. The condition is very common in women as compared to men, despite the fact that when it strikes males, it is usually more serious. Rosacea usually happens to people between the age of 30 and 50 and people feel that individuals who have them just have a serious case of acne or sunburn. Other symptoms are stinging and burning sensation, enlarged blood vessels in the face that leads to appearance of red lines, and in severe cases among males, the swelling of the nose.

As yet, it is still unknown what is the precise cause of this problem. Nevertheless, lots of doctors have dialed-in some elements that help develop this situation such as occurence of flushing. But one other factor is diet. There are people who have reported that eating a certain kind of food can lead to flushing, and stinging sensation which can then develop into rosacea.

One substance found in food that may trigger Rosacea is histamine. Histamine initiates vasodilation and therefore it will amplify the symptom of rosacea. These food consist of cheese, alcohol, dried fruits, chocolate, milk, tomatoes, and more.

An additional substance that may improve the likelihood or rosacea is Niacin. Niacin, also known as vitamin B3 can increase the dilation of blood vessels which in turn leads to flushing. Some of the food rich in Niacin consist of eggs, spinach, lobster, salmon, tofu, and shrimp.

Some people who have rosacea reported varying degrees of sensitivity to foods containing salicylates, observing that those meals seem to worsen their symptoms. Food that have high salicylates content include champagne, wines, tea, honey, ginger, pepper, mint, almonds, peanuts, pineapples, raisins, chili, green peppers, radish, and many more.

Diets that are high in carbohydrates and sugars naturally causes the body to produce more insulin. Insulin secretion produces Phospholipase A2 which induces the pro-inflammatory Arachidonic Acid products, which in turn aggravates the symptoms of rosacea. Some of the foods that are high in carbohydrates are rice, bread, pasta, beans, potatoes, rice, bran, and cereals.

Advice on Treating Rosacea

 

Rosacea is often a reoccuring skin situation that commonly affects Caucasians and fair skinned individuals, thus earning it a nickname of “the curse of the Celts”. It generally impacts the central part with the face, in the cheeks, nose, chin, and forehead. The major signs or symptoms include facial erythema or reddening in the skin, inflammatory papules and pustules, regular flushing with persistent redness, blood vessel lines, as well as in its severe stage, the thickening of the skin inside the nose causing it to develop a knobby appearance.

Most women are more likely to have this problem than men despite the fact that it really is more critical for the latter. The onset of this situation typically happens during 30-40 years old. Inside U.S. alone, it can be estimated that 14 million individuals have rosacea. Even though it’s mostly a simple issue, its moderate and serious stage may well lead to drastic changes towards the look in the impacted individual, therefore causing shame and social discomfort. Although the cause of rosacea is not yet identified, its effects are curable.

There are 2 ways to deal with rosacea. The first method is by way of self-help where the affected particular person tries to deal with the results of rosacea through his/her own efforts. Using self-help, the person may well prevent the factors that trigger flushing so that you can prevent the condition from aggravating, for example alcohol, arduous exercises, sunlight, vasodilating drugs, warm water baths, astringents and so on. The individual may also use beauty products such as anti-redness cream which could decrease facial erythema.

Meanwhile folks impacted with mild stages of rosacea could also use topical treatment options that are applied directly to the skin. Some of the topical remedies that might be applied are azelaic acid that reduces pigment formation, sodium sulfacetamide thatreduces the redness, and topical metronidazole which also acts as antibacterial and antiprotozoal .

Oral remedy is also an option to handle rosacea, especially when it leads to papules and pustules or if there is eye involvement. Antibiotics and isotretinoin are employed in oral therapy.

An additional remedy that might be utilized for rosacea is laser surgery. It really is typically prepared for cases that are in severe stages. Laser surgery is often a non-invasive procedure that targets lesions inside inflamed blood vessels. Laser surgery is also applied to treat the redness of the skin, telangiectasias, and rhinophyma.

Advice on Lsar Treatments for Rosacea

 

Rosacea, a chronic skin color disorder which is marked by redness and inflammation of the central part of the face, is a situation that may trigger social discomfort for those who’re impacted by it because of the changes in look that they may possibly experience. Most individuals who’re affected by this situation are adults aged between 30 to 50, and it can be far more frequent in women than males, despite the fact that its effects are a lot more uncomfortable in the cases of the latter. Those who suffer slight to moderate situations of rosacea may be dealt with medically utilizing mouth and topical treatment, whilst individuals in critical stages are dealt with surgically with the use of laser.

You can find various kinds of lasers utilized for healing rosacea: pulsed dye laser, pulsed Nd, intense pulsed light source (IPL), and CO2 lasers. These lasers are employed to deal with the negative consequences of rosacea that brought on lesions within the blood vessels, which can be done in a targeted, non-invasive method. One particular example is the treatment of telangiectasias, or dilated blood vessels that brings about visible wrinkles in the face. Lasers may also be employed to deal with the frequent flushing and face blushing that go with rosacea. Rhinophyma, an effect of rosacea that leads to the thickening on the epidermis in the nose producing a knobby, bulbous look, are also treated employing lasers.

Given that laser surgery is often a non-invasive process, the use of anesthesia in wiping out skin lesions is optional and dependent on the pain threshold of the affected individual. Anesthesia is nonetheless essential in treating rhinophyma as it really is a more complicated process. Multiple therapy is essential for healing general lesions though in the case of eradicating telangiectasia with smaller vessels, 1 remedy is typically enough.

The affected individual may possibly encounter quite a few effects of the laser surgery right after the treatment. Bruising is a really common reaction that can last for 7 as much as 10 days. Pain, swelling and inflammation are also commonly experienced by patients right after the surgery that will subside inside of 24 to 48 hours. Mild crusting of the epidermis can also develop in some circumstances. The darkening of skin as a result of postinflammatory hyperpigmentation can also be a frequent occurrence, but it’s going to only last briefly.
